2016-09-20 110 views
0

我試圖運行一個本地主機Dev App Engine,通過Jetty運行我的應用程序。由於看到了開發App Engine的開始:Jetty在Google App Engine上的調試應用程序(localhost)

[INFO] Sep 20, 2016 9:43:39 AM com.google.appengine.tools.development.AbstractModule startup 
[INFO] INFO: Module instance default is running at http://localhost:8080/ 
[INFO] Sep 20, 2016 9:43:39 AM com.google.appengine.tools.development.AbstractModule startup 
[INFO] INFO: The admin console is running at http://localhost:8080/_ah/admin 
[INFO] Sep 20, 2016 9:43:39 AM com.google.appengine.tools.development.DevAppServerImpl doStart 
[INFO] INFO: Dev App Server is now running 

我試着在http://localhost:8080/_ah/admin訪問管理頁面:

HTTP ERROR: 404 

Problem accessing /_ah/admin. Reason: 

    NOT_FOUND 
Powered by Jetty:// 

我懷疑我的應用程序已經墜毀,機上碼頭。 Hows有沒有一個調試呢?

我不知道你們需要哪些信息來幫助。告訴我!

回答

1
  1. 您必須使用遠程調試jvm參數更新appengine-maven-plugin,如下所示。

    <configuration> <jvmFlags> <jvmFlag>-Xdebug</jvmFlag> <jvmFlag>-agentlib:jdwp=transport=dt_socket,address=5005,server=y,suspend=n</jvmFlag> </jvmFlags> </configuration>

  2. 然後使用mvn appengine:devserver命令

  3. 點你的IDE到遠程調試端口(5005)

+0

你瞎猜,並創下運行開發服務器。確切的問題!配置被放到8000而不是5005!謝謝! –

相關問題